Harris+Hoole in Guildford is looking for a Shift Leader to enhance customer experience and lead the team in delivering excellent service. The role offers fantastic training, career growth opportunities, and great perks including unlimited free drinks and food discounts. The starting rate is £12.76 per hour, escalating with service. A positive attitude and energy are essential. You'll be part of a supportive team committed to providing a friendly environment for staff and customers alike.

How to prepare for a job interview at Harris+Hoole
✨Know the Company
Before your interview, take some time to research Harris+Hoole. Understand their values, mission, and what makes them unique in the café scene. This will help you connect your answers to their ethos and show that you're genuinely interested in being part of their team.
✨Show Your Energy
As a Shift Leader, a positive attitude and energy are key. During the interview, let your enthusiasm shine through. Share examples of how you've delighted customers in the past or led a team with positivity. This will demonstrate that you embody the spirit they’re looking for.
✨Prepare for Situational Questions
Expect questions about how you would handle specific situations, like dealing with a difficult customer or motivating your team during a busy shift. Think of examples from your previous experiences that highlight your leadership skills and ability to maintain excellent service under pressure.
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
At the end of the interview, have a few questions ready to ask. Inquire about the training process, opportunities for career growth, or how they foster a supportive environment. This shows that you’re not just interested in the job, but also in contributing to the café's success and culture.
